Something Stirred [Part Five]

It stood framed on the threshold, poison coiling in its mind, flesh blending with the blackness, limbs climbing in and out of the night. The man lay in his bed, sheets draped lovingly across his body, the only divide between his flesh and the world. I let him in. Dreams tumbled within dreams, the twines twisting. The man still slept. The thing stepped closer, moving through the half-light, the floor gasping in protest. I let him in. A wind stirred the curtains; a locust cried somewhere in the distance. Long, worn fingers drew back the bed-sheet, nails skimming the man’s skin. He seemed so perfect; he seemed so right — I let him in. A breath.
